Clear weather windows and prime seasonal viewing

Best visibility for a mountain flight Kathmandu is during Nepal’s clear seasons: October–November (post-monsoon clarity) and March–May (pre-monsoon). Early morning departures (roughly 6:00–9:00 AM) are preferred because afternoon thermals and cloud build-up can obscure mountain views. For peak clear skies and the classic “pink Everest” at sunrise, schedule your Everest Scenic Flight in these months and request early flight times.

Typical flight route and duration

Most flights depart Tribhuvan International Airport (Kathmandu) early morning. Aircraft climb over the Kathmandu Valley, head northeast toward the Langtang and then the Khumbu region, make a sweeping pass near the Everest massif (sometimes circling the peak for visibility), and return to Kathmandu. Total time: roughly 60 minutes (including climb and descent); airborne scenic time often 25–40 minutes depending on routing and weather. Best time of day and season for clarity

Optimal months: October–November and March–May. Best daily window: sunrise to late morning (06:00–08:30). Avoid monsoon months (June–September) for clear views. Search terms: best time for Everest flight, Everest flight visibility.

Safety and aircraft types

Flights are operated on small, mountain-capable fixed-wing aircraft, often DHC-6 Twin Otter or similar. Companies comply with Civil Aviation Authority of Nepal (CAAN) regulations. Best Time for the Mountain Flight from Kathmandu 
 

The best time to take the Everest mountain flight in Nepal is during autumn (September to November) and spring (March to May). During these ideal seasons, the skies are clearest. You can enjoy most breathtaking views of Himalayas from plane in autumn and spring months.

The autumn season comes after the rainy season. So, air feels fresh and clean with outstanding visibility.  The skies are cloud free in the early morning. So, you can get clear and striking view of Mount Everest and nearby peaks. In addition, golden autumn morning light hitting snowy peaks rewards you with truly magical scenery. The weather is usually calm and stable during this season. So, taking mountain flight at this time is smooth and comfortable.

The spring season is just as rewarding. The skies are mostly clear in spring. The landscape below is vibrant with blooming wildflowers. The colorful hills, valleys and snow covered mountains during spring are absolutely stunning.
